The setup is straightforward — you're given a grid map with hidden tiles. Each tile conceals either a treasure chest, a bonus item, or a trap. You pick tiles one at a time, collecting whatever is underneath. The more tiles you reveal without hitting a trap, the higher your accumulated multiplier grows. You can cash out at any point, or keep digging and risk it all for a bigger reward.
What makes Treasure Hunt on ZeeTwin different from a basic pick-and-win game is the depth of the reward system. There are five chest tiers — from the humble Wooden Chest all the way up to the Diamond Vault — and each tier has its own multiplier range and special bonus triggers. Some tiles reveal map fragments that unlock a hidden bonus zone with extra chests. Others reveal cursed skulls that end your round immediately. In ZeeTwin Treasure Hunt, your payout is calculated by multiplying your round bet by the total accumulated multiplier at the point you cash out — or at the point the round ends. Each chest you find adds its multiplier to your running total. The deeper you dig without hitting a trap, the higher your total grows. The single most effective strategy in ZeeTwin Treasure Hunt is deciding on a cash-out target before the round begins and sticking to it. It sounds simple, but in practice it's surprisingly hard to do — the temptation to dig one more tile is real, especially when you're on a good run. Decide before you start whether you're aiming for 20×, 50×, or 100×, and cash out the moment you hit that number. Players who set targets and honour them consistently outperform players who chase the Diamond Vault every round.
ZeeTwin Treasure Hunt's three risk modes — Safe, Classic, and Daring — aren't just about multiplier size. They also change the trap density on the map. Safe mode is designed for longer sessions with a smaller budget, because the lower trap density means you'll complete more rounds before hitting a losing streak. Daring mode is better suited to short, high-stakes sessions where you're comfortable losing several rounds in a row in exchange for a shot at the 1000× Diamond Vault.
